Description
This CPD course is filmed in High Definition Video and accompanied by Power Point Slides and Course Notes, which are engagingly written, highly comprehensive and accessible to all learners. It covers 1 hours of CPD training, arming you with the highest level of topical knowledge, and is set out as follows:
Section 1: Definitions
- What does Director mean?
- Categories of Director?
- Fiduciary Duties?
- Duties owed in service contracts
Section 2: Statutory Duties?
- Sections 171 - 177 Companies Act 2006
- Relief from Liability
Section 3: Potential Criminal Liability
- Potential Criminal Liability under s.206-211 Insolvency Act 1986
- Statement of Insolvency Practice 2
- Section 6 of Company Directors' Disqualification Act 1986
- Further Insolvency Act 1986 Offences
